Cars near Mesochora
Top locations for car rentals
National Car Rental at nearby airports
National Car Rental near Mesochora
- National Car Rental car hire in Kalabaka
- National Car Rental car hire in Ioannina
- National Car Rental car hire in Trikala
- National Car Rental car hire in Greek Mainland
- National Car Rental car hire in Metsovo
- National Car Rental car hire in Mouzaki
- National Car Rental car hire in European Union
- National Car Rental car hire in North Tzoumerka
- National Car Rental car hire in Pyli
- National Car Rental car hire in Arta
- National Car Rental car hire in Dodoni
- National Car Rental car hire in Pertouli
- National Car Rental car hire in Elati
- National Car Rental car hire in Central Tzoumerka
- National Car Rental car hire in Vourgareli
- National Car Rental car hire in Syrrako
- National Car Rental car hire in Argithea
- National Car Rental car hire in Decentralized Administration of Thessaly and Central Greece
- National Car Rental car hire in Melissourgoí
- National Car Rental car hire in Kalarites
- National Car Rental car hire in Pramanta
- National Car Rental car hire in Iraklia
- National Car Rental car hire in Trapezaki
- National Car Rental car hire in Tsopela
- National Car Rental car hire in Alonaki
- National Car Rental car hire in Mediterranean Region
- National Car Rental car hire in Pamvotida
- National Car Rental car hire in Agrafa
- National Car Rental car hire in Desi
- National Car Rental car hire in Neraidochori
- National Car Rental car hire in Vragkiana
- National Car Rental car hire in Ziros
Top car rental companies in Mesochora
- Alamo Rent A Car car hire in Mesochora
- Budget car hire in Mesochora
- Enterprise car hire in Mesochora
- Hertz car hire in Mesochora
- Thrifty Car Rental car hire in Mesochora
- Avis car hire in Mesochora
- Dollar Rent A Car car hire in Mesochora
- Sixt car hire in Mesochora
- National car hire in Mesochora
- Fox Rental Cars car hire in Mesochora
- Payless car hire in Mesochora
- Europcar car hire in Mesochora